Transaction 21e3e15346e056bcb038fb71102797df80c07cfffe1792642318773b9651c95a

1 Input
2 Outputs
  • 21e3e15346e056bcb038fb71102797df80c07cfffe1792642318773b9651c95a:0
  • value  3211398
    address  38MzaA4VDAmcjUaSDSA7KLdyraQfaTXoMu
  • 21e3e15346e056bcb038fb71102797df80c07cfffe1792642318773b9651c95a:1
  • value  8311980
    address  3BKEXWykF7qEAFa5xjTJ9AofssnoQXTsNg